Transaction 520fb421a966498d79a88ead3fb7a7b20f38edf864adfa7c18849841536ea5f4
1 Input
1 Output
-
520fb421a966498d79a88ead3fb7a7b20f38edf864adfa7c18849841536ea5f4:0
- value
- 45457
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22e5c1febec9551e7eab75aff5d83f8b2af15ff2 OP_EQUAL
- address
- 34sY8vAAovTR7WBKX4vwaD8C5rRr4TyknD